As an end-to-end responsive space company, Firefly Aerospace is on a mission to enable our world to launch, land, and operate in space – anywhere, anytime. Our small- to medium-lift launch vehicles, lunar landers, and orbital vehicles allow us to service the entire lifecycle of government and commercial missions from low Earth orbit to the Moon and beyond. We utilize carbon composite structures, patented propulsion technologies, and common components across our vehicles to iterate quickly, improve reliability, and deliver payloads at a lower cost.

SUMMARY:

Quality Assurance owns the processes and tools by which Firefly identifies, contains, eliminates, and prevents non-conformances. Quality is charged with defining and maintaining the processes and tools which prove product capabilities meet requirements and result in a predictably economical and reliable product.

The Firefly Quality Specialist is responsible for inspection and acceptance of qualification and flight hardware and software products. Verifying that all key performance and design characteristics are met prior to launch, Quality Specialists play a critical role in ensuring mission success. R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Develop and execute detailed inspection programs (Zeiss Calypso) which assure adherence to design, specification, and testing requirements - ensuring that all actions required for product acceptance are conducted accurately and efficiently.
  • Perform inspections on launch vehicle/spacecraft components and sub-assemblies using advanced metrology equipment to evaluate product (Zeiss CMM)
  • Maintain tool control and calibration processes within assigned work center - including validation of metrology systems.
  • Participate in technical operations and offer guidance and/or serve as an additional technical resource.
  • Initiate and execute plans to improve product quality and inspection efficiency.
  • Apply 5S workplace organization & follow the Lean initiatives.
  • Support manufacturing compliance to customer and internal specifications to meet contractual and mission requirements.
